Green harvesting, in which sugarcane "trash" is harvested for electricity, cattle feed, medicine and other uses instead of being burnt on site, could make money for the sugar industry while protecting both the health of Glades residents and the quality of the environment, writes the Sierra Club's Patrick Ferguson.
